Brake Dust and Contaminants affect Visual Consistency
Brake dust is one of the biggest challenges in automotive photography preparation. Modern braking systems generate microscopic metal particles that accumulate quickly around wheels, especially on performance and sports vehicles. This buildup creates several problems:
- Dark residue around wheel spokes
- Uneven surface coloration
- Reduced metallic shine
- Texture inconsistencies visible under close-up shots
Photographers frequently shoot detailed wheel close-ups to highlight design craftsmanship. In these images, even minor contamination becomes highly visible.
Specialized automotive wheel cleaners are designed to break down stubborn contaminants without damaging sensitive finishes such as polished aluminum, chrome plating, matte coatings, or painted alloy surfaces.
By thoroughly cleaning wheels before a shoot, photographers ensure consistency across every visible component of the vehicle.
Professional Shoots Demand Full Vehicle Preparation
Preparing a vehicle for professional photography involves far more than washing the exterior paint. Automotive photographers and detailers understand that every visible component contributes to overall presentation. Standard pre-shoot preparation often includes:
- Full exterior wash and paint decontamination
- Tire cleaning and dressing
- Glass polishing
- Interior detailing for cabin shots
- Wheel and brake component cleaning
Among these steps, wheel cleaning is especially important because wheels sit low to the ground where dirt, road tar, mud, and contaminants accumulate fastest.
Luxury car advertisements, dealership photography, motorsport promotions, and editorial automotive shoots all demand extremely high presentation standards. Missing even one preparation step can compromise the quality of the final images.
A professionally cleaned wheel setup helps maintain visual consistency from bumper to bumper.
